Lift Me UpRihanna

Lift Me Up was chosen as the theme song for the film Black Panther: Wakanda Forever and drew a great deal of attention.
It is sung by the world-renowned diva Rihanna.
The lyrics carry a message that, although losing a loved one is heartbreaking, they will forever remain in our hearts.
It is said that the song is dedicated to Chadwick Boseman, who played the film’s protagonist and later passed away.
The song also ties in with the film’s storyline, so I encourage you to check them out together.
DaylightDavid Kushner

Beginning with a quiet piano introduction, American singer-songwriter David Kushner’s song uses light and darkness symbolically to portray conflicting desires.
The lyrics, skillfully interweaving biblical imagery, depict the struggle with a toxic relationship and deliver a message that resonates with many.
Released in April 2023, the track became a viral hit on TikTok and climbed high on charts around the world.
Accompanied by orchestral sounds, Kushner’s vocals seem to speak directly to the listener’s heart.
It’s a recommended track for anyone seeking light and hope in everyday life.

What a wonderful worldLouis Armstrong

Louis Armstrong, affectionately known around the world as “Satchmo,” was beloved by many.
With his wide, purse-like mouth, meticulous enunciation, and exceptional expressiveness, he was highly praised by countless artists.
“What a Wonderful World” is his most famous work, featuring peaceful lyrics that advocate against war.
Compared to the melody’s sense of happiness, the message is remarkably powerful—so be sure to check out the Japanese translation.

This work by Manchester-born rapper Bugzy Malone, released in April 2024, is an introspective track themed around dialogue with the past.
It recounts late-night conversations from his youth, the hardships they overcame together, and even time spent in prison.
It’s a remarkable piece that conveys gratitude for lost friendships and pays homage to the comrades who shared those struggles.
Showcasing Bugzy’s artistic talent, the song beautifully fuses a melodic tone with his signature lyricism.
While looking back on the past, it also looks forward, signaling an evolution in his musicality—making it a standout new release.
Lose ControlTeddy Swims

A soulful song that portrays a heart swaying between love and dependence.
Released in June 2023 by American artist Teddy Swims, this track is included on his debut album, “I’ve Tried Everything But Therapy (Part 1).” With his powerful vocals and deeply expressive delivery, he sings of intense feelings for a lover and the anxiety of losing himself.
In March 2024, it reached No.
1 on the Billboard Hot 100, setting a record as the longest climb to the top by a solo male artist, taking 32 weeks.
It’s a highly recommended track that will resonate with anyone who has experienced both the joys and pains of love.
Here For It AllMariah Carey

This piece, the title track and final song of the album Here For It All released in September 2025, begins as a piano-led ballad that gradually rises into a gospel-like swell.
The lyrics, which vow to remain “here” despite hardship and loss, are layered with a time-weathered vocal timbre and prayerful ad-libs, giving it a mature, universal quality distinct from the power ballads of the ’90s.
It stands as a symbolic number that Mariah Carey released under a new, strongly independent framework through her own imprint.
It’s a deeply resonant song I recommend for moments when you want to face yourself honestly, and when you want to feel the bonds you share with someone anew.
Be AlrightDashboard Confessional

Dashboard Confessional is an American rock band known for emotional melodies that empathize with the listener’s heart.
In 2018, after a nine-year hiatus, they released the album “CROOKED SHADOWS,” which includes the song “Be Alright.” As the title suggests, the vocals repeatedly reassure, “It’s okay, it’ll be alright,” carrying a message of overcoming sorrow.
Stuck with UAriana Grande & Justin Bieber

With the stay-at-home trend, everyone has been spending more time at home, right? This is the kind of piece that lifts your spirits when you’re feeling down at times like that.
It’s a collaboration by two big stars, Justin Bieber and Ariana Grande, and the video is a montage of dance clips that have become popular since the pandemic.
The two vocalists also recorded their parts from home, creating a single work together with their fans.
The lyrics are essentially a “call” that reflects the state of the world.
